Soil Microbes involved in Global Warming

Global warming is speeding up the activity of soil microbes so much so that the loss of carbon from soils could off-set reduction goals in the use of fossil fuels. First results of the Deep Impact mission to discover more about the composition of the comet Tempel 1 reports more organic molecules. Analysing the pigments used to illluminate the Book of Kells in the year 800.
